Zach Campbell

Assistant Professor 10 Months Email Memorial Hall, Room 216
Professor Campbell teaches Spanish, French, and Latin American literature. His research uses close reading to explore the crossroads of literature and history. 

Courses Taught

  • SPA 141, 142, & 243 (Spanish I & II, Intermediate Spanish)
  • FRE 101 & 102 (French I & II)
  • The Latin American Novel (MLG 322)

Education

  • PhD, Department of Spanish & Portuguese (Literature in Spanish), Rutgers University - New Brunswick, 2019 – Summa cum Laude

Publications

  • Zachary Campbell, El Apocalipsis de Santa Teresa: Tomóchic! Redención! como pensamiento del destierro (The Apocalypse of Santa Teresa: Tomóchic! Redención! as Exile Thought), Connotas. Revista de crítica y teoría literarias (Connotas, Journal of Literary Theory and Criticism), (30) 2025, 1-32.
  • Zachary Campbell, Blessed be Discord, 1910: Ricardo Flores Magón's Manifesto Mode, Bulletin of Latin American Research, 40(2) 2020, 285-298.
